Did my daughter break the law?

My 14 year old daughter's first igment this year was a 9/11 project and they let the kids do anything they wanted, poem, picture, sculpture etc. She made a beautiful power point slide show of different 9/11 images and set it to Lee Greenwood's God Bless the USA. She presented it to her cl today (about 25 kids) and they applauded and her teacher gave her an "A". I was proudly telling a co-worker about it and they said that she could get in trouble for publicly using that song without permission. Can she? It seems like it wouldn't be any different than someone playing it on a CD player or something.
